Diesel is cheaper, Diesel is cheaper!  Well it is, however I’m not hearing this chanted in the streets. I get more of a sense that folks are just waiting for the price to go up again, rather than enjoying the recent relief in prices.   It’s like we are experiencing eye of a hurricane.   Drivers have been tormented by high prices over the course of the last 16 months, and they know it’s coming again.   Diesel prices are down $.50 from the recent peak in on April 2, 2012.

Still using veggie?  Yes sir.  Lots of us are still using veggie.  It’s not only about saving money, it’s Energy Independence.   Many of us are immune to the emotional and financial battering of unstable and ever-increasing fuel prices.
